YOGURT RICE

This cooling Indian dish is perfect as an accompaniment to grilled meats. Curry leaves can be found at your local Indian store. If you can't find them, they can be omitted, but they do add a unique flavor and smell.

Time 1h10m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 cup jasmine rice
2 cups water
1 tablespoon ghee (clarified butter)
1 dried red chile pepper, broken in half
1 teaspoon black mustard seeds
½ teaspoon ground turmeric
4 fresh curry leaves
1 pinch asafoetida powder
¼ cup milk
1 cup plain yogurt
salt to taste

Steps:

  • Bring rice and water to a boil in a saucepan over high heat. Reduce heat to medium-low, cover, and simmer until the rice is tender, 20 to 25 minutes.
  • Heat the ghee in a small skillet over medium heat. Add the broken chile pepper, and cook until fragrant, about 30 seconds. Stir in the black mustard seeds, and cook until they begin to pop, about 30 seconds more. Remove from the heat, and stir in the turmeric, curry leaves, and asafoetida powder.
  • Whisk the milk, yogurt, and spice ghee together in a large bowl until smooth. Fold in the rice until well mixed. Season to taste with salt, then allow to cool to room temperature before serving.
